Insights for Sector 45, Gurgaon Real Estate Market Overview

Sector 45 represents a mature and highly sought-after residential hub in Gurgaon, characterized by a diverse inventory that spans ready-to-move projects and established villa communities. Recent quarterly trends show property values moving from ₹12,450 to ₹16,100 per sq ft, indicating a strong appreciation trajectory that benefits long-term stakeholders. The rental segment remains active, with average rates hovering at ₹33 per sq ft and a variety of configurations catering to different lifestyle needs. Development remains focused on maximizing the utility of available land, balancing high-end apartments with spacious villas to maintain the sector's premium appeal.

  • Apartment rates in the sector have seen a 3.32% positive change, reflecting healthy demand for high-rise living.
  • Well-occupied projects in the area have recorded an impressive 18.64% price growth, signaling high resident satisfaction and stability.
  • Rental yields of 2.46% make the sector an attractive proposition for investors seeking consistent monthly returns.
  • Studio apartments and large 4 BHK units offer a wide range of rental options, with monthly rates starting from ₹21,850 up to ₹71,700.
  • Established projects like Shree Ganesh Apartments CGHS continue to lead the market with competitive rental and capital values.

What is the current average asking price in Sector 45, Gurgaon?

As of June 2026, the average asking price in Sector 45 is ₹16,100 per sq ft. This figure reflects a significant market movement, having appreciated by 29.21% compared to the previous period, indicating strong demand and investor confidence in this locality.

How have property prices in Sector 45 trended over the last few quarters?

Property prices in Sector 45 have shown a dynamic trajectory, with the location rate moving from ₹13,200 per sq ft in September 2025 to ₹12,450 in December 2025, before rising to ₹16,100 in March 2026 and reaching ₹16,600 per sq ft as of June 2026. This upward trend in the most recent quarters suggests a resilient market recovery and sustained interest from buyers looking for established residential pockets.

How do property prices compare between apartments and villas in Sector 45?

As of June 2026, apartments in Sector 45 command an average price of ₹16,600 per sq ft, which has appreciated by 3.32% compared to the previous period. In contrast, villas are priced at an average of ₹43,750 per sq ft, reflecting a depreciation of 7.48% over the same timeframe, which may present a unique entry point for luxury buyers interested in low-density housing.

What is the difference between the average asking price and the Government Registration Rate in Sector 45?

As of June 2026, the average asking price in Sector 45 stands at ₹16,100 per sq ft, while the Government Registration Rate is ₹7,000 per sq ft. This gap is a critical data point for buyers to note, as it highlights the difference between current market valuations and the baseline value used for official property registration purposes.

How do property prices in Sector 45 vary by project status?

As of June 2026, property prices in Sector 45 are segmented by status: 'Well Occupied' projects lead at ₹17,200 per sq ft (appreciating by 18.64%), 'Under Construction' projects are priced at ₹14,500 per sq ft (remaining stable with 0% change), and 'Ready To Move' projects average ₹12,050 per sq ft (depreciating by 4.11% from the previous period). This data helps buyers choose between immediate occupancy and potential future value appreciation.

What is the average rental rate and rental yield in Sector 45?

As of June 2026, the average rental rate in Sector 45 is ₹33 per sq ft, which has seen a depreciation of 10.81% compared to the previous period. The locality currently offers a rental yield of 2.46%, a key metric for investors to evaluate the annual income potential of their property relative to the capital investment required.

What are the typical monthly rental rates for different BHK configurations in Sector 45?

As of June 2026, the rental market in Sector 45 offers diverse options: Studio apartments average ₹21,850 per month, 1 BHK units average ₹32,750 per month, 2 BHK units average ₹39,750 per month, 3 BHK units average ₹61,750 per month, and 4 BHK units average ₹71,700 per month. This tiered pricing structure allows tenants to choose a configuration that best fits their budget and space requirements.
